Transaction eca961ba24df24f2c7e20ff522ac3c81e0ce28880578a77c543956e780311ca6
1 Input
1 Output
-
eca961ba24df24f2c7e20ff522ac3c81e0ce28880578a77c543956e780311ca6:0
- value
- 574579
- script pubkey
- OP_0 OP_PUSHBYTES_20 38bd582ae20a15849b28696a6a1e6a2593fb6440
- address
- bc1q8z74s2hzpg2cfxegd94x58n2ykflkezq25lg42